Tim Hudson And Braves Go Down To Blue Jays

|


TORONTO (AP) - Vernon Wells homered and drove in three runs to

help the Toronto Blue Jays beat the Atlanta Braves 9-5 on Saturday.

Rod Barajas hit a solo homer and John Parrish won for the first

time since May 19, 2007, for Baltimore against Washington. Parrish

allowed one run and four hits in six innings.
